Here are some surefire concerns to ask prior to employing a mover:

• The length of time has the moving business been in company?
Experience counts and a track record reveals their capability to deliver each and every time. For example, have they moved many kids' clay handprints and know they are simply irreplaceable? No amount of insurance coverage is going to ever provide you those back.

• Are they licensed?
If you are looking for a moving company to move you from state to mention the moving business ought to have a United States DOT number, which is a distinct license number issued by the United States Department of Transport. If you're looking for a moving company to move your things in your own state they need a state license.

• Is the business guaranteed?
Never utilize a moving business without a license number or insurance. Neither is an uninsured or unlicensed bunch of folks who call themselves a moving business or a group of guys who really just do moving as a side job. If not, you might want to think about additional moving insurance.

• Have they won any awards or distinctions for service? Can they show you any letters of suggestion?
If they haven't won any awards for service, opportunities are they aren't going to win any awards from you. Keep in mind a great credibility absolutely conserves you money. NOBODY gives a radiant review to a business that over promised, under provided and over charged.

• Do they have any reviews see here online?
Make certain to check out the business's rating with the Better Organisation Bureau (BBB). Social media websites such as Yelp, Citysearch and TrustLink will also offer you a look into other individuals's experiences with the company. Make yelpers your brand-new BFFs.

• What do their rates actually include?
Will they provide you a much better rate if you move on a Sunday as opposed to a Monday? Repeat your new mantra: Great Track record equals Great Rates. And repeat once again: no one wins awards or fantastic evaluations when they overcharge!

• Do you have any special debt consolidation policies or delivery windows?
If you are moving out of state, ask the business to discuss them in information. Is the moving company forth coming about the truth that long distance relocations almost constantly include a delivery window not a precise shipment date?

• Will the moving crew wrap and secure your furniture to prevent damages? How lots of movers will be on the job? For how long will the task take? Are there sufficient hours in the day? Will you be charged if there is overtime?
By law a moving business can just give you rates on the phone not approximates on the phone. Does the moving business provide totally free on website estimates?
